Amiga
The Amiga is a family of personal computers introduced by Commodore in 1985.

Atari ST
The Atari ST is a line of home computers from Atari Corporation and the successor to the Atari 8-bit family.

Linux
Linux is a family of free and open-source software operating systems built around the Linux kernel.

Macintosh
The Macintosh (pronounced as; branded as Mac since 1998) is a family of personal computers designed, manufactured, and sold by Apple Inc. since January 1984.

Microsoft Windows
Microsoft Windows is a group of several graphical operating system families, all of which are developed, marketed, and sold by Microsoft.

Nintendo DS
The Nintendo DS, or simply DS, is a dual-screen handheld game console developed and released by Nintendo.
